Assoc. Prof. Dr. Kessara Thanyalakpark (Dr. Yui), Managing Director of Sena Development Public Company Limited, revealed that Sena’s success stems from a decade-long vision of sustainable housing. Sena was the first property developer in Thailand to commit to “Zero Energy Homes”, having incorporated solar rooftop technology for over 13 years.
The company champions a bold approach: “Daring to lead, act early, and innovate before others.” This means ensuring that homeowners can access clean energy technology at a reasonable cost and benefit immediately from homeownership—most notably through electricity savings that extend throughout the 25-year lifespan of the solar system.
Now, with the government’s policy supporting residential Solar Rooftop installations, homeowners can receive up to THB 200,000 in personal income tax deductions within the same tax year the home is purchased. Sena buyers automatically qualify for this benefit, making homeownership more appealing, financially sensible, and aligned with long-term sustainability goals.

Aligned with Government Policy—Supporting Easier Access to Green Homes
Sena’s strategy aligns with national efforts to make energy-saving homes more accessible. Homebuyers can take advantage of Green Loan packages from partner banks at interest rates lower than standard housing loans, easing the path to ownership.
Sena’s “Zero Energy Home” vision not only helps reduce environmental impact but also enables real low-carbon living. In addition, homeowners can earn The 1 points every month based on carbon credit savings—redeemable through Sena’s partner network until December 31, 2025.
